How Our Team Handles Aquarium Leak Water Removal
Aquarium leak water removal needs a meticulous process to ensure that every drop of water is extracted and your property is restored to its original condition. Our team follows a step-by-step approach to guarantee a successful outcome:
Step 1: Assessment and Containment
We begin by assessing the extent of the damage and containing the affected area to prevent further water flow. Our technicians use specialized equipment to extract standing water and dry the area quickly.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Next, we use powerful pumps and wet vacuums to remove any remaining water from the affected area. This step is crucial in preventing further damage and reducing the risk of mold growth.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We use industrial-grade dehumidifiers and air movers to dry the area thoroughly and prevent moisture from accumulating. This step is essential in preventing secondary damage and ensuring a complete restoration.
Step 4: Sanitizing and Disinfecting
Once the area is dry, we sanitize and disinfect the affected area to prevent the growth of bacteria, mold, and mildew. This step is critical in maintaining a healthy indoor environment.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Restoration
Finally, we conduct a thorough inspection to ensure that the area is completely dry and restored to its original condition. Our technicians will make any necessary repairs and provide you with a detailed report of the restoration process.

Aquarium Leak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small leak in a small aquarium | Yes | No | Easy to contain and repair with basic tools and equipment. |
| Large leak in a large aquarium | No | Yes | Needs specialized equipment and expertise to contain and repair. |
| Water damage to surrounding areas | No | Yes | Needs professional equipment and expertise to extract water and dry the area. |
| Mold or mildew growth | No | Yes | Needs specialized equipment and expertise to sanitize and disinfect the affected area. |
| High-value or irreplaceable items damaged | No | Yes | Needs professional expertise to restore and preserve valuable items. |
| Insurance claim required | No | Yes | Needs professional documentation and expertise to navigate the insurance claims process. |

Aquarium Leak Water Removal Cost In San Manuel, AZ
The cost of aquarium leak water removal in San Manuel, AZ can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our prices range from $500 to $2,500, with the average cost being around $1,500. Keep in mind that these are estimates, and the final cost will depend on an on-site assessment.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ction | $500 – $1,500 | Size of affected area, type of flooring, and amount of water extracted. |
| Drying and dehumidification | $300 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, type of flooring, and amount of moisture present. |
| Sanitizing and disinfecting | $200 – $500 | Size of affected area, type of materials, and level of contamination. |
| Final inspection and restoration | $100 – $300 | Size of affected area, type of repairs needed, and level of expertise required. |
| Emergency services (after hours or weekends) | 10% – 20% surcharge | Availability of technicians, travel time, and level of urgency. |
